Transaction 51d8b0c210155a3f3165fbd86453b08eae61eccec1f2604e2dbd3c7cc17cbaad
1 Input
1 Output
-
51d8b0c210155a3f3165fbd86453b08eae61eccec1f2604e2dbd3c7cc17cbaad:0
- value
- 43629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e3c3dac74e8d1c879cb4518730d96b9f8e7d12c OP_EQUAL
- address
- 3QsHit2r2smuAnsg6KWRFKB5bt2ZikkZq7